Federal Laws That Protect You as a Borrower
Beyond New Jersey law, three federal statutes provide the foundation of borrower protection nationwide:
-
TILA
Truth in Lending Act — 15 U.S.C. § 1601
Requires every lender to disclose the exact APR, total finance charge, monthly payment amount, and full repayment schedule before you sign. Toms River emergency cash borrowers must receive the same disclosures as any other borrower — no exceptions. -
ECOA Compliance
Equal Credit Opportunity Act — 15 U.S.C. § 1691
Prohibits lenders from discriminating based on race, color, religion, national origin, sex, marital status, age, or receipt of public assistance. You must receive a written denial with specific reasons within 30 days if your application is declined. -
Consumer Financial Protection Bureau
Consumer Financial Protection Bureau — consumerfinance.gov
The CFPB supervises consumer lenders at the federal level and enforces TILA and ECOA. Toms River, NJ borrowers can file a complaint online if a lender engages in deceptive practices — the CFPB requires lenders to respond within 15 calendar days.
